A Study on Ego Resiliency on Melancholy in the Students of Dental Hygiene College
Jang Sung-Yeon

Kim Hyun-Kyung
Abstract
This study was conducted to suggest the recognition of importance and the necessity of management by identifying the self elasticity elements which affect the depression of dental hygiene department students. Study subjects were targeting 600 female students who were enrolled in dental hygiene department in six three-year course universities and the survey was conducted from September 2012 to December 2012. 553 collected survey data were analyzed with SPSS 19.0 version program. 1. Significant differences in self elasticity according to general characteristics were identified in age, experience to study one more year, subjective family economy level, satisfaction about the department of major, satisfaction about the university. 2. Significant differences in depression according to the general characteristics were identified in subjective family economy level, satisfaction about the university and satisfaction about the department of major and significant differences in the subcategories of depression were identified in loneliness, helplessness and worthlessness. 3. Confidence, effectiveness in personal relations, optimistic attitudes which are the composing elements of self elasticity were identified to positively affect the depression and as the self elasticity was higher, the depression was lower. 4. As the self elasticity positively affects the depression, it is considered that the school should have the curriculum to raise the liberal arts knowledge and the development of personal counseling program and education which is required to prevent and mediate the depression.
